Roof Gutter Cleaning in Rochester, NY
Roof gutter cleaning services involve the removal of leaves, debris, and buildup from the gutters and downspouts to ensure proper water flow away from the property. This service covers a variety of projects, including clearing clogged gutters, inspecting for damage or leaks, and ensuring that the drainage system functions effectively during heavy rain or snowmelt. Homeowners often request gutter cleaning to prevent water damage, foundation issues, and basement flooding, especially in areas prone to seasonal debris accumulation.

Roof Gutter Cleaning Questions
Why should gutter cleaning be scheduled regularly? Regular cleaning helps prevent clogs, water damage, and structural issues caused by debris buildup in gutters.
What types of debris are typically removed during gutter cleaning? Common debris includes leaves, twigs, dirt, and small nests that can obstruct water flow.
Is gutter cleaning necessary after storms or heavy winds? Yes, cleaning after storms ensures that any fallen debris is removed to maintain proper drainage.
How can clogged gutters affect a property? Clogged gutters can lead to water overflow, foundation damage, and potential mold growth inside the home.
